What is the main focus of the nursing process in health promotion and maintenance?

Explanation:
Assessment of the patient's health needs forms the foundation of nursing care in health promotion and maintenance. By gathering comprehensive data—physical status, risk factors, knowledge and beliefs, social supports, and living environment—the nurse identifies priorities, guides education and prevention strategies, and establishes baselines to track progress. This assessment drives the entire nursing process: after understanding needs, a plan is created, actions are carried out, and outcomes are evaluated to support ongoing health and prevent decline. While administering medications, discharge planning, and administrative tasks are important parts of care, they do not define the focus of the process in health promotion, which begins with a thorough assessment.
